WebbRather than addressing the symptoms caused by a deviated septum, it corrects the problem itself, thus offering long-term relief from symptoms. Septoplasty is an outpatient procedure that doesn’t require any cutting through the skin, since it’s performed entirely through the nostrils.
WebbSince septoplasty is an outpatient procedure, you will be able to go home the same day of your surgery after the anesthesia has worn off.
